Description chemical structure of 1,2,3-tri-tert-butylrhodocenium - Rh(n5-C5H5)(n5-C5tBu3H2). Modeled after: Rhodocenium Complexes Bearing the 1,2,3-Tri-tert-butylcyclopentadienyl Ligand: Redox-Promoted Synthesis and Mechanistic, Structural and Computational Investigations. Bernadette T. Donovan-Merkert, C. Reid Clontz, Leslie M. Rhinehart, Howard I. Tjiong, and Clifford M. Carlin, Organometallics, 1998, 17, 1716-1724. (Not based on exact x-ray structure coordinates.)
